Draw a right triangle in quadrant IV,
indicate the reference angle (the one inside the
triangle with one side as the x-axis) with an
arc:



Since matrix%281%2C3%2Ctangent%2C%22%22=%22%22%2Copposite%2Fadjacent%29,
label the opposite side to the reference angle as the numerator
of -7/6  which is -7 (negative since the opposite side goes
down) and the adjacent side as +6 (positive since it goes
right.



Find the hypotenuse by the Pythagorean theorem:
